Summary
To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, pursuant to the Answer of 22 October 2020 to Question 99130 on Coronavirus: Vaccination, what preparations the Government is making for the mass distribution of a covid-19 vaccine.

5 November 2020
Answer
The Government has asked the National Health Service to be ready to deploy any safe, effective vaccines when available. Planning considerations include the size and make-up of the workforce needed to deliver a potentially extensive vaccination programme a...
